Subject: [Xen-devel] [PATCH v2 1/2] x86/mm: factor out the code for shattering an l3 PTE

map_pages_to_xen and modify_xen_mappings are performing almost exactly
the same operations when shattering an l3 PTE, the only difference
being whether we want to flush.

Signed-off-by: Hongyan Xia <hongyxia@amazon.com>

---
Changes in v2:
- improve asm.
- re-read pl3e from memory when taking the lock.
- move the allocation of l2t inside the shatter function.

+/* Shatter an l3 entry and populate l2. If virt is passed in, also do flush. */
+static int shatter_l3e(l3_pgentry_t *pl3e, unsigned long virt, bool locking)
+{
+    unsigned int i;
+    l3_pgentry_t ol3e;
+    l2_pgentry_t ol2e, *l2t = alloc_xen_pagetable();
+
+    if ( l2t == NULL )
+        return -1;
+
+    ol3e = *pl3e;
+    ol2e = l2e_from_intpte(l3e_get_intpte(ol3e));
+
+    for ( i = 0; i < L2_PAGETABLE_ENTRIES; i++ )
+    {
+        l2e_write(l2t + i, ol2e);
+        ol2e = l2e_from_intpte(
+                l2e_get_intpte(ol2e) + (1 << (PAGETABLE_ORDER + PAGE_SHIFT)));
+    }
+    if ( locking )
+        spin_lock(&map_pgdir_lock);
+    if ( (l3e_get_flags(*pl3e) & _PAGE_PRESENT) &&
+         (l3e_get_flags(*pl3e) & _PAGE_PSE) )
+    {
+        l3e_write_atomic(pl3e,
+                l3e_from_paddr((paddr_t)virt_to_maddr(l2t), __PAGE_HYPERVISOR));
+        l2t = NULL;
+    }
+    if ( locking )
+        spin_unlock(&map_pgdir_lock);
+    if ( virt )
+    {
+        unsigned int flush_flags =
+            FLUSH_TLB | FLUSH_ORDER(2 * PAGETABLE_ORDER);
+
+        if ( (l3e_get_flags(ol3e) & _PAGE_GLOBAL) )
+                flush_flags |= FLUSH_TLB_GLOBAL;
+        flush_area(virt, flush_flags);
+    }
+    if ( l2t )
+        free_xen_pagetable(l2t);
+
+    return 0;
+}
